The Preventive Effects of Lycii fructus Extract Against LPS-induced Acute Hepatotoxicity

The purpose of this study was to investigate the preventive effects of Lycii fructus Extract (LFE) against the acute hepatotoxicity-inducing lipopolysaccharide (LPS) in the liver. LFE of 100mg/kg concentration was intraperitoneally administered into rats at dose of 1.5ml/kg for 20days. On the day 21, 1.5ml/kg of LPS dissolved in saline was injected 4 hours before anesthetization. We examined the levels of glutamate oxaloacetate transaminase(GOT), glutamate pyruvate transaminase(GPT), lactate dehydrogenase(LDH) in serum of rats, superoxide dismutase(SOD) in mitochondrial fraction, and malondialdehyde(MDA), catalase(CAT), glutathione peroxidase(GPx) in liver homogenate. LPS-treatment markedly increased the levels of GOT, GPT, LDH and MDA, and significantly decreased those of SOD, CAT and GPx. But LFE-pretreatment decreased the levels of GOT, GPT, LDH and MDA, by 17.7%, 27.5%, 40.7% and 56.9%, respectively and increased those of SOD, CAT and GPx, by 90.5%, 78.9% and 83.8%, respectively. These results showed that the LFE had the preventive effects against the acute hepatotoxicity-inducing LPS in the liver.
